Разные недочеты/баги

mix-7
Posts: 906
Joined: 11.05.2018 11:02

Re: Разные недочеты/баги

Post by mix-7 »

По ссылкам в CudaText https://synwrite.sourceforge.net/forums ... 541#p18541

ответите?
main Alexey
Posts: 2543
Joined: 25.08.2021 18:15

Re: Разные недочеты/баги

Post by main Alexey »

По ссылкам- поправлю правило для ссылок. у меня поправлено. в Гит это залью позже.
main Alexey
Posts: 2543
Joined: 25.08.2021 18:15

Re: Разные недочеты/баги

Post by main Alexey »

В обычном тексте дают ссылки и запятая обрывает ссылку. так что обрывать на запятой полезно. как и на закрывающей скобке.
mix-7
Posts: 906
Joined: 11.05.2018 11:02

Re: Разные недочеты/баги

Post by mix-7 »

Здравствуйте!
Я обычно после ссылки ставлю пробел. Но ладно.

В CudaText 1.206.0.0, linux-x86_64-qt5, fpc 3.2.3 пропали макросы, нет меню Macros.
Консоль:

Code: Select all

Python 3.11.6
Init: cuda_macros
Traceback (most recent call last):
  File "/home/one/.config/cudatext/py/cuda_macros/cd_macros.py", line 82, in on_start
    self._do_acts(acts='|reg|menu|')
  File "/home/one/.config/cudatext/py/cuda_macros/cd_macros.py", line 610, in _do_acts
    self.adapt_menu()
  File "/home/one/.config/cudatext/py/cuda_macros/cd_macros.py", line 97, in adapt_menu
    if PLUG_AUTAG in [it['tag'] for it in top_its]:
                     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
  File "/home/one/.config/cudatext/py/cuda_macros/cd_macros.py", line 97, in <listcomp>
    if PLUG_AUTAG in [it['tag'] for it in top_its]:
                      ~~^^^^^^^
KeyError: 'tag'
ERROR: Exception in CudaText for on_start: KeyError: 'tag'
Init: cuda_code_tree_x
Init: cuda_vim_mode
Init: cuda_breadcrumbs
И есть тормоза.
Например, при клике на меню Plugins CudaText иногда замирает в первый раз после старта.
То же и в CudaText 1.205.5.2, linux-x86_64-qt5, fpc 3.2.3

Иногда
Last edited by mix-7 on 24.12.2023 09:57, edited 1 time in total.
main Alexey
Posts: 2543
Joined: 25.08.2021 18:15

Re: Разные недочеты/баги

Post by main Alexey »

>пропали макросы, нет меню Macros.
Из-за изменения АПИ. решение - обновите все плагины из addons manager.

>при клике на меню Plugins CudaText замирает в первый раз после старта.
в readme/history.txt описано почему.
add: make app start faster by 30ms (on Alexey's PC), by moving top menu initing (and Plugins menu filling) to 'app is idle' event
mix-7
Posts: 906
Joined: 11.05.2018 11:02

Re: Разные недочеты/баги

Post by mix-7 »

CudaText 1.206.5.1, linux-x86_64-qt5, fpc 3.2.3
при редактировании в splitter tab CudaText периодически зависает.
Лексер WikidPad, Ubuntu 23.10
Все плагины обновлены.
main Alexey
Posts: 2543
Joined: 25.08.2021 18:15

Re: Разные недочеты/баги

Post by main Alexey »

зависает как?
- перестает раскрашиваться текст, но редактор работает
или
- вообще зависает, даже верхнее меню не работает

файл cudatext.error (в home dir) не создался?
main Alexey
Posts: 2543
Joined: 25.08.2021 18:15

Re: Разные недочеты/баги

Post by main Alexey »

показ code-tree влияет на зависы?

на чистой Куде (с лексером wikidpad) есть повтор?
может надо просто держать клавишу с буквой нажатой и зависает? проверил счас, не виснет в markdown.
mix-7
Posts: 906
Joined: 11.05.2018 11:02

Re: Разные недочеты/баги

Post by mix-7 »

Отвечу последовательно.
Проверил сейчас гипотезу: отключил ~/.config/cudatext/py/cuda_folding_caption/plugin_disabled - не помогло.
Кстати, зависание, но меньшее было даже на нерасщепленной вкладке!

> показ code-tree влияет на зависы?

Переключил на snippet panel, Greek Alphabet (lower) - есть зависы на расщепленной полувкладке.
С Project также естьб зависы, если быстро вводить короткие строки, абракадабру (как и раньше)

Заметил (С Project, на полувкладке):
если быстро ввести случайные символы, 5 строк:

Code: Select all

врарыва

ырпрыер

ыврырыр

варыырыр

ырррырарары
А потом почти без пауз выделять Shift + Arrow Up, зависает на 4 строке.

> зависает как?

Не реагирует ни на что, даже иногда, чаще, когда был включен cuda_folding_caption, было системное сообщение
"CudaText не отвечает, Завершить принудительно или подождать?"


> может надо просто держать клавишу с буквой нажатой и зависает?

Нет, при автоповторе не виснет.


> на чистой Куде (с лексером wikidpad) есть повтор?

Сейчас попробую, сообщу в отдельном посте.
Post Reply